Roberta's obituary

Roberta Richards-Wager, aged 63, passed away on August 10, 2024, in Crown Point, IN. Born on December 27, 1960, Roberta dedicated many years of her life to serving the community as a Customer Service Manager at Strack & Van Til in Schererville, Indiana, a role she held from 2005 until her retirement in 2023.

Roberta is survived by her loving family: daughter Jennifer Sprouse; grandchildren Elijah Sprouse, Jude Sprouse, Giana Sprouse, Giorgio Fabsits, and Gianluca Fabsits; and son Richard Fabsits. She was preceded in death by her parents Frank & Caroline McGue, her sisters Carole Mistretta and Betty Mogan, her nephew Mike Luchesi, and her grandparents Elizabeth and Joseph Mistretta.

A devout member of St. Christopher Church, Roberta's faith played a significant role in her life. Her memorial services will be held at St. Christopher Church, located at 4130 147th St., Midlothian, IL, on August 30, 2024, at 10 am.

Roberta will be remembered for her unwavering dedication to her family and her community, leaving behind a legacy of kindness and service. Her presence will be deeply missed by all who knew her.
